This “Boring” Canadian Stock is up 70x since IPO

from The Canadian Investor · host Braden Dennis & Simon Belanger

It’s earnings season and we talk about some well known Canadian and US stocks including Amazon, Meta, Canada Goose, TFI International and Lightspeed Commerce!
